For monosubstituted alkylphenols, the position of the alkyl radical relative to the hydroxyl function is designated either with a numerical locant or ortho, meta, or para. The alkyl side chain typically retains a trivial name. Thus 4-(l,l,3,3-tetramethylbutyl)phenol, 4-/ f2 octylphenol, and para-tert-octy Tph.eno (PTOP) all refer to stmcture (1). [Pg.57]

MICROWAVE-ASSISTED SOLVENT EXTRACTION AND A NEW METHOD FOR ISOLATION OF TOTAL PETROLEUM HYDROCARBONS (TPH) FROM PLANTS WITH COLUMN CHROMATOGRAPHY (SILICA GEL AND ALUMINA) AND DETERMINATION WITH SPECTROFLUOROPHOTOMETRY... [Pg.270]

The efficiencies of total petroleum hydrocarbons (TPH) transfer into various solvents from plants by microwave enhanced process were extracted. [Pg.270]

Microwave extraction realized at 120 °C for 30 min with Hexane -Acetone (3 2 V/V) as the extraction solvent was identified as the most effective extraction procedure for isolation of TPH from biotic matrices. The aim of this research is to develop a silica gel and alumina fractionation procedure for plant sample extraction. Column chromatography with two solvents (chloroform and hexane dichloromethane) as a mobile phase were used for clean-up of extract. In this research the efficiency of recovery received from chloroform as a mobile phase. [Pg.270]

Nonvolatile Nitrosamines In Tobacco. A method which we developed several years ago for the analysis of tobacco-specific nitrosamines (TSNA 31) involves extraction of tobacco with buffered ascorbic acid TpH 4.5) followed by partition with ethyl acetate, chromatographic clean-up on silica gel, and analysis by HPLC-TEA (Figure 9). Results obtained with this method for a large spectrum of tobacco products (Table IV), strongly support the concept that the levels of nitrate and alkaloids, and especially the methods for curing and fermentation, determine the yields of TSNA in tobacco products. Recent and as yet preliminary data from snuff analyses indicate that aerobic bacteria play a role in the formation of TSNA during air curing and fermentation. [Pg.258]

When only a single dose of METH (10 mg/kg) was administered, TPH activity returned to normal in all areas within 2 weeks after administering the drug (Bakhit and Gibb 1981). However, with repeated administration of METH (five doses, given every 6 hours), TPH activity in the neostriatum, cerebral cortex, nucleus accumbens, and hippocampus recovered to some extent but remained significantly depressed 110 days after the last dose of the drug had been administered neostriatal TH activity was also depressed after 110 days. [Pg.162]

Whether the serotonergie responses to METH eould be attenuated by DA antagonists was next examined (Hotchkiss and Gibb 1980). Surprisingly, haloperidol, administered concurrently, prevented the METH-induced decrease in neostriatal TPH activity (figure 2). Similar responses were observed in the cerebral cortex. [Pg.164]

When 3,4-methylenedioxymethamphetamine (MDMA) or MDA was administered to rats in a single dose, TPH activity was markedly depressed. [Pg.166]

Multiple doses of MDMA or MDA resulted in a further decline in TPH activity (figure 4). In contrast to METH, however, neither MDA nor MDMA altered neostriatal TH activity. The decrease in TPH activity was accompanied by a dramatic decrease in 5-HT and 5-HIAA concentrations these changes in TPH activity and in 5-hydroxyindole content also occurred in other serotonergic terminal areas such as the hippocampus and cerebral cortex. The possible role of DA in the MDMA-indueed alterations of the serotonergie system was then examined. Teehniques previously used in studying the role of DA in the METH-indueed neuroehemieal effeets were employed. When DA synthesis was inhibited with MT, the effeet of multiple doses of MDMA on TPH activity (figure 6) and eoneentrations of 5-HT and 5-HIAA was attenuated. The degree of proteetion with MT seemed to be a funetion of the size and number of doses of MDMA used as well as a funetion of the serotonergie parameter that was measured. [Pg.168]
